In 1968, a French veterinarian named Jean Cathary developed the first dog meal and Royal Canin was born. Cathary wanted to make pet meals that would be based on research, scientific data, and precise diets to accommodate specific needs.

Since the 1960s, the brand has expanded to cover the globe. It launched in the US in 1985, and has since been purchased by the Mars PetCare umbrella. That being said, Royal Canin still maintains its headquarters, plus , all of its products are made in in-house manufacturing facilities.

Royal Canin has headquarters and production plants in Missouri and South Dakota. All of their ingredients are sourced from farms in these two states, as well. Although the global Royal Canin company states they source worldwide, they also have a ten-point quality testing protocol which includes checking for things such as mycotoxins and oxidation. Royal Canin Veterinary Diet Gastrointestinal Low Fat Dry Dog Food

This dry dog food from Royal Canin is designed for pooches who have trouble digesting fat. It contains omega-3 fatty acids, DHA, and EPA which have been sourced from fish oil. This keeps your dogs coat and skin healthy, and also nourishes their GI tract.

Some digestive problems that this food can aid with include loose stools, vomiting, and poor appetite. Easy-to-digest proteins and prebiotics are used in the recipe to help soothe your poochs digestive system. Prebiotics also work to maintain healthy levels of good bacteria in your poochs gut.

As well as being good for your dogs digestive health, this dry food also keeps your furry friends immune system functioning normally. A mixture of antioxidants is added into the food to aid with this.

Based on reviews for this dry dog food, a lot of owners have found this product works well with dogs with digestive issues. This is most likely due to the easy-to-digest proteins and prebiotics in the recipe.

A couple of downsides with this dry dog food is its flavor and kibble size. Some pooches are not too fond of the taste and the size of the kibble is a bit on the large side. If you own a small breed dog, then the kibble size may be a bit too big for them to chew.

This dry dog food does contain a couple of controversial ingredients like chicken by-product meal, so this is also something to be aware of.

Transitioning To Homemade Dog Food

Most dogs dont have a problem making the switch to homemade food. If yours is prone to digestive issues, start slowly by mixing a little bit of the homemade food with the commercial food.

Over the course of a week or two, gradually increase the amount of homemade food while decreasing the commercial food.

If your dog vomits or has diarrhea, try introducing only a couple of new ingredients at a time until their systems are well adjusted to the fresh diet.

For dogs with health issues, please consult with a veterinarian if you arent sure what kind of supplements are needed. Use your best judgment, the way you would when feeding yourself or your family.

Royal Canin Puppy Food 2022 Review

Our overview wouldnt be complete without a thorough look at their options for younger dogs, so heres an in-depth Royal Canin puppy food review.

When looking at their puppy recipes, theyre very similar in composition and ingredients to the adult recipes.

In this sense, the main ingredients are still very similar. However, we like that dehydrated poultry protein is the very first ingredient, with animal fats as the third and pork protein in a close sixth place. The total protein content is slightly higher than in their adult recipes, clocking at around 30%. This is enough to feed your little one as they grow strong and healthy.

When it comes to variety, Royal Canins puppy line also offers plenty of choice. Theres a general line with options for puppies of all sizes, from mini to giant and you can also find breed-specific recipes. In general, the recipes are very similar and the main changes are in kibble size or texture.

All in all, this is a good option for your pup considering the nice protein percentage and kibble options.

Has Royal Canin Dog Food Been Recalled

Yes, Royal Canin Dog Food has been recalled the company has three recalls.

In February 2006, the company recalled Royal Canin Veterinary Diet dog and cat food containing high vitamin D3.

Similarly, in April 2007, the Food and Drug Administration recalled the Royal Canin Veterinary Diet and Sensible Choice dog foods because of high vitamin D3 levels.

The last recall was in May 2007, when Royal Canin was asked to recall various Royal Canin formulas such as Sensible and Kasco Choice due to possible melamine contamination.

Royal Canin Hepatic Dog Food Ingredients

Because this food is made as a veterinary formula, the ingredients are a bit different. Dogs with liver problems require specific nutrition that other dogs dont. Therefore, this foods ingredient list is a bit different.

The first ingredient is brewers rice, which is extremely nutritious. It is often used as a nutritional supplement in other dog foods. However, it is included in high amounts in this food because it is so energy-dense.

The rest of this food is mostly corn and brown rice. These ingredients are extremely low in natural copper, which is exactly why it is utilized in this formula.

There is zero meat in this formula. The only animal product is chicken fat, which does not include any protein. Soy protein isolate is used instead to up the protein content in this food.

The rest of the food is mostly added vitamins and minerals, which are required to support your dogs complete health.
